This essay provides a historical analysis of the World Wars, focusing on the formation and significance of NATO (North Atlantic Treaty Organization) as a defense pact against the Soviet Union. It examines the context surrounding the establishment of NATO, the challenges it faced, and its impact on European security. The essay highlights the role of General Dwight D. Eisenhower, the first Supreme Allied Commander, Europe (SACEUR), in shaping public opinion and establishing NATO as a legitimate military force. It discusses the political and social factors that influenced NATO's development, the alliance's strengths and weaknesses, and its contribution to nation-building. The analysis includes insights into the relationship between America and Europe, the influence of key figures, and the aftermath of the World Wars, emphasizing the importance of historical context in understanding contemporary political and socio-economic situations. The essay also evaluates the merits and limitations of the scholarly work, providing a comprehensive overview of the topic.
